A tender offer might, for instance, be made to purchase outstanding stock shares for $18 a share when the current market price is only $15 a share. The reason for offering the premium is to induce a large number of shareholders to sell their shares.
A tender offer is a chance to sell some of your private company shares. Usually, this means selling vested stock back to the company or to approved buyers. The offer is often available for a limited time and at a set price. Current employees, former employees and even outside investors may be eligible.
Although not defined in the rules and regulations of the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C), it is widely understood that a "tender offer" is an offer to purchase some or all of a corporation's publicly traded stock directly from the company's stockholders with cash, the bidder's stock (known as an exchange offer

A cash tender offer is a proposal made by an investor or a company to purchase some or all of shareholders' shares at a specified price, usually at a premium over the current market price, in order to gain control of the company.
Typically, any entity or individual that intends to acquire a significant amount of shares in a public company and is making a cash tender offer is required to file with the appropriate regulatory authorities, such as the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C) in the United States.
To fill out a cash tender offer, one must complete the required forms provided by the regulatory authority, including details such as the offer price, number of shares being purchased, the duration of the offer, and any conditions that must be met for the offer to be valid.
The purpose of a cash tender offer is to acquire shares directly from shareholders, often to gain control over a company or to take a company private, and to encourage shareholders to sell their shares.
The information that must be reported on a cash tender offer typically includes the offer price, the number of shares being sought, the identity of the offeror, the purpose of the offer, and any financing arrangements related to the offer.
